Vivo streamlines and enhances its cell phone and AR/VR product designs using RCWA in OpticStudio

OpticStudio's native RCWA algorithm enables the company to boost productivity to stay competitive in a fast-moving market.

China-based Vivo designs and develops consumer telecommunication devices and related technologies, including smartphones, smartphone accessories, software, and online services.

The customers for Vivo's products are continuously seeking new features and improvements that give them the latest and greatest applications of optics technologies, including diffractive optical elements, or DOEs, which utilize the wave characteristics of light to achieve new levels of functionality, performance, and miniaturization for camera lenses, as well as for augmented reality and virtual reality (AR/VR) equipment. Designs that include DOE require diffractive optics simulation capabilities that go beyond those for traditional geometric optics.

To achieve these DOE capabilities, Vivo wrote macros and other code that implemented the new simulation types needed for testing and tolerancing the DOE-based designs. Along the way, the company remained mindful of the ongoing need to achieve the levels of miniaturization and performance their customers expected. To achieve the time-to-market goals required for keeping up a competitive advantage, Vivo wanted a highly reliable way of doing this work more quickly.

Using the native support for rigorous coupled-wave analysis (RCWA) introduced in the January 2020 release of OpticStudio 20.1, Vivo saved time with their DOE-based optical simulations and analyses, replacing the need to write and test macros for each new DOE optical design.
